Mondo Description Any Neu-Laxova syndrome in which the cause of the disease is a mutation in the PHGDH gene.
Uniprot Description A lethal, autosomal recessive multiple malformation syndrome characterized by ichthyosis, marked intrauterine growth restriction, microcephaly, short neck, limb deformities, hypoplastic lungs, edema, and central nervous system anomalies including lissencephaly, cerebellar hypoplasia and/or abnormal/agenesis of the corpus callosum. Abnormal facial features include severe proptosis with ectropion, hypertelorism, micrognathia, flattened nose, and malformed ears.
Disease Ontology Description A serine deficiency that is characterized by multiple fatal malformations including ichthyosis, microcephaly, central nervous system abnormalities, limb deformities, intrauterine growth restriction, proptosis, anasarca, and micrognathia, and has_material_basis_in autosomal recessive inheritance of mutation in the PHGDH gene on chromosome 1p12, causing issues producing the amino acid serine.
